tonylong
25th of July 2009 (Sat), 22:19
My dad really likes using this lens on his 5D2, will a 16-35 2.8 work just as well on my 50D?

Sure, a 16-35 will be approximately as wide on a 50D as a 24-70. Of course, the 17-55 f/2.8 IS will be about as wide and a bit longer, so it's whether you want the L or the EF-S with IS. Both are excellent lenses.

But with a full frame, the 24-70 definitely hums.

egordon99
6th of August 2009 (Thu), 14:47
i picked up a 24-70L as well.
to me, the picture seems soft.
this was shot with a 40d @ F2.8 1/125 70mm ISO100 580EX flash
do you guys think its the camera that is limiting the image quality?

this is an unaltered picture
384984

You're shooting pretty close @ f/2.8, so the DOF is VERY shallow. Her nose/around her nose is plenty sharp, but once you leave the "area of acceptable focus", things soften up VERY quickly. Have you shot a fast lens before?

I'd say that image looks perfectly fine.

single_track
8th of August 2009 (Sat), 08:13
Nothing handy with the 40d, which I do not use much any more. Here is one with my 5d. full frame and then 100%. No sharpening, iso800, 1/125s. Not a great shot but I think it shows the capabilities of the lens. I like eye lash and eye brow shots because they are easy to duplicate by others. Let me know what you think.

I do notice a slight sharpening from f2.8 to f4, but it is very slight. For all intents, this is sharp wide open. DOF is challenging, of course, which could leave the impression of soft images.
